On Tue, May 29, 2018 at 01:02:15PM +0300, Matti Vaittinen wrote: > @@ -0,0 +1,677 @@ > +/* S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0 */ > +/* Copyright (C) 2018 ROHM Semiconductors */ > +/* > + * bd71837-regulator.c ROHM BD71837MWV regulator driver > + */
The SPDX header (and the rest of the block) need to be C++ comments.
> +static int bd71837_regulator_set_regmap(struct regulator_dev *rdev, int set)
> +{
> + int ret = -EINVAL;
> + struct bd71837_pmic *pmic = rdev->reg_data;
> +
> + /* According to the data sheet we must not change regulator voltage
> + * when it is enabled. Thus we need to check if regulator is enabled
> + * before changing the voltage. This mutex is used to avoid race where
> + * we might enable regulator after it's state has been checked but
> + * before the voltage is changed
> + */
> + mutex_lock(&pmic->mtx);
> + if (!set)
> + ret = regulator_disable_regmap(rdev);
> + else
> + ret = regulator_enable_regmap(rdev);
> + mutex_unlock(&pmic->mtx);
> +
This still has the weird locking/wrapper thing going on. The regulator
core will ensure that only one operation is called on a given regulator
at once.
